增加权限码控制
This commit is contained in:
@@ -68,8 +68,8 @@ export default {
|
|||||||
detail: ResidentDetail
|
detail: ResidentDetail
|
||||||
})),
|
})),
|
||||||
{label: "居民统计", value: "3", comp: ResidentSta},
|
{label: "居民统计", value: "3", comp: ResidentSta},
|
||||||
{label: "居民档案审核", value: "4", comp: auditList, detail: auditDetail}
|
{label: "居民档案审核", value: "4", comp: auditList, detail: auditDetail, permit: "app_appresident_examine"}
|
||||||
]
|
].filter(e => !e.permit || this.permissions(e.permit))
|
||||||
}
|
}
|
||||||
},
|
},
|
||||||
created() {
|
created() {
|
||||||
|
|||||||
@@ -202,7 +202,8 @@
|
|||||||
</ai-card>
|
</ai-card>
|
||||||
<tags-manage v-if="currentTab=='0'&&baseInfo.id&&permissions('app_appresidentlabelinfo_detail')" v-bind="$props" :resident-id="baseInfo.id"/>
|
<tags-manage v-if="currentTab=='0'&&baseInfo.id&&permissions('app_appresidentlabelinfo_detail')" v-bind="$props" :resident-id="baseInfo.id"/>
|
||||||
</el-tab-pane>
|
</el-tab-pane>
|
||||||
<el-tab-pane label="资产信息" lazy>
|
<!--暂时用审核的权限码控制,后端没时间加-->
|
||||||
|
<el-tab-pane label="资产信息" lazy v-if="permissions('app_appresident_examine')">
|
||||||
<personal-assets v-if="currentTab==1&&baseInfo.id" :resident-id="baseInfo.id" v-bind="$props"/>
|
<personal-assets v-if="currentTab==1&&baseInfo.id" :resident-id="baseInfo.id" v-bind="$props"/>
|
||||||
</el-tab-pane>
|
</el-tab-pane>
|
||||||
<el-tab-pane label="特殊人群" lazy v-if="hasSpecial">
|
<el-tab-pane label="特殊人群" lazy v-if="hasSpecial">
|
||||||
|
|||||||
Reference in New Issue
Block a user